10 Best Foods to Eat for Sculpted Abs: Your Ultimate Guide to a Defined Core

Most people think endless crunches are the secret to visible abs. The reality is much different.

Strong abdominal muscles can exist underneath a layer of body fat. If your nutrition isn’t supporting fat loss and muscle recovery, those abs may never become visible no matter how many workouts you complete.

The good news is that certain foods can help support a leaner physique by improving satiety, preserving muscle mass, reducing cravings, and helping you maintain a calorie deficit.

If you’re working toward a flatter stomach and more defined core, these foods deserve a spot on your plate.

Why Nutrition Matters More Than Crunches

Exercise builds abdominal muscles, but diet determines whether you can actually see them.

Visible abs generally require:

  • Lower body fat levels
  • Adequate protein intake
  • Controlled calorie consumption
  • Consistent hydration
  • Strength training

Research consistently shows that nutrition plays the biggest role in reducing body fat.

How Body Fat Affects Ab Definition

Your abdominal muscles become more visible as body fat decreases.

While genetics influence where fat is stored, nutrition can help reduce overall body fat by:

  • Supporting muscle retention
  • Managing hunger
  • Stabilizing blood sugar
  • Improving workout performance

The foods below can help create the conditions needed for a leaner midsection.

10 Best Foods for Sculpted Abs

1. Greek Yogurt

Why It Helps

Greek yogurt is packed with protein while remaining relatively low in calories.

Benefits include:

  • Supports muscle recovery
  • Helps control appetite
  • Contains probiotics for gut health

Best Way to Eat It

Combine plain Greek yogurt with berries and chia seeds for a protein-rich breakfast.

2. Salmon

Why It Helps

Salmon provides high-quality protein and omega-3 fatty acids.

Benefits include:

  • Supports muscle growth
  • Helps manage inflammation
  • Promotes recovery after workouts

Aim for two servings weekly.

3. Spinach

Why It Helps

Spinach is extremely nutrient-dense and low in calories.

Benefits include:

  • High fiber content
  • Supports digestion
  • Helps increase fullness

Add spinach to smoothies, omelets, salads, and wraps.

4. Oats

Why It Helps

Oats provide slow-digesting carbohydrates that help maintain steady energy levels.

Benefits include:

  • Rich in soluble fiber
  • Helps reduce cravings
  • Supports workout performance

Pair oats with protein for a balanced meal.

5. Eggs

Why It Helps

Eggs remain one of the most complete protein sources available.

Benefits include:

  • Supports lean muscle development
  • Helps control hunger
  • Contains essential amino acids

A protein-rich breakfast often leads to better food choices throughout the day.

6. Berries

Why It Helps

Blueberries, raspberries, and strawberries are naturally lower in calories while providing antioxidants.

Benefits include:

  • Supports recovery
  • Helps manage sweet cravings
  • Provides fiber for fullness

Use berries in smoothies, yogurt bowls, or oatmeal.

7. Chicken Breast

Why It Helps

Chicken breast delivers a large amount of protein with minimal fat.

Benefits include:

  • Preserves lean muscle
  • Supports fat loss goals
  • Keeps you satisfied longer

It’s one of the most effective foods for building a lean physique.

8. Avocados

Why It Helps

Healthy fats can support satiety and hormone function.

Benefits include:

  • Helps control hunger
  • Provides fiber
  • Supports heart health

A small serving goes a long way.

9. Cottage Cheese

Why It Helps

Cottage cheese contains casein protein, which digests slowly.

Benefits include:

  • Supports overnight muscle recovery
  • Helps reduce late-night hunger
  • High protein, relatively low calorie

It’s a popular snack among fitness enthusiasts.

10. Quinoa

Why It Helps

Quinoa provides both complex carbohydrates and plant-based protein.

Benefits include:

  • Sustained energy
  • High fiber content
  • Supports recovery and muscle maintenance

It works well as a replacement for refined grains.

Foods That Can Hide Your Abs

Even healthy workouts can be undermined by poor food choices.

Try limiting:

Sugary Drinks

  • Soda
  • Sweet tea
  • Energy drinks

Highly Processed Foods

  • Chips
  • Cookies
  • Pastries

Excess Alcohol

Alcohol contributes calories while often increasing cravings and reducing recovery quality.

Refined Carbohydrates

  • White bread
  • White pasta
  • Sugary cereals

These foods can make maintaining a calorie deficit more difficult.

Simple Abs Diet Tips That Actually Work

Prioritize Protein at Every Meal

Protein helps:

  • Build muscle
  • Reduce cravings
  • Increase satiety

Aim for a protein source every time you eat.

Stay Hydrated

Water supports:

  • Digestion
  • Recovery
  • Performance

Many people mistake thirst for hunger.

Eat More Fiber

Fiber helps:

  • Improve fullness
  • Support digestion
  • Manage appetite

Good sources include:

  • Vegetables
  • Fruits
  • Oats
  • Beans
  • Seeds

Strength Train Consistently

Nutrition reveals abs, but resistance training helps build them.

Sample One-Day Meal Plan for Defined Abs

Breakfast

Greek yogurt with berries and chia seeds

Snack

Apple with almond butter

Lunch

Grilled chicken salad with avocado

Snack

Cottage cheese with blueberries

Dinner

Salmon with quinoa and roasted vegetables

Evening

Herbal tea and water

This type of meal plan provides protein, fiber, healthy fats, and complex carbohydrates without excessive calories.

Common Mistakes That Slow Results

Avoid these common issues:

  • Eating too little protein
  • Drinking calories
  • Skipping meals
  • Ignoring portion sizes
  • Relying on supplements
  • Expecting spot reduction

No food burns belly fat directly, but consistent healthy eating can help reduce overall body fat over time.

Final Thoughts

Visible abs aren’t created through one special food or one workout.

The combination of:

  • High-protein foods
  • Fiber-rich vegetables
  • Healthy fats
  • Consistent exercise
  • Smart recovery habits

creates the foundation for a stronger, leaner core.

Adding these 10 foods to your routine can support fat loss, muscle recovery, and long-term fitness goals while helping you move closer to the defined abs you’re working toward.

FAQs

What foods help reveal abs fastest?

Protein-rich foods such as Greek yogurt, chicken breast, salmon, eggs, and cottage cheese can help preserve muscle while supporting fat loss.

What is the best breakfast for abs?

A breakfast containing protein and fiber, such as Greek yogurt with berries or oatmeal with protein, can help reduce cravings and improve satiety.

Can you get abs without dieting?

Exercise alone is usually not enough. Nutrition plays a major role in reducing body fat, which helps reveal abdominal muscles.

Are carbohydrates bad for abs?

No. Complex carbohydrates such as oats, quinoa, sweet potatoes, and fruit can support workout performance and recovery when eaten in appropriate portions.
